kawakasi
i had the 1.4 shim in. i installed the .08 and didnt noticed any squel so installed the .06 shim. i tryed the 13lb thumb pull and measured with mics, i seam to be in range. i will try to go smaller. i noticed that the belt is riding at the very top of 2ndary sheaves. any tighter it would be over the top. would that be normal?

here's the beef chief went out to the garage and tryed the .03 shim, no squell. it wheelied a little easyer. so i said well take it out , and tryed with no shims. it wheelied easyer than with the .03 shim. it does have a small squell sometimes, once awhile in gear at idle. i would just bump the throtle and it would go away. i seen someone liked it a little tight so i will try it and see what happens. it only takes me about 20 minutes to install the shim, so why not try it for a little bit. if the squell goes away then i will leave it, if not maybe i will install the .03 shim back in. the dyna cdi will take care of the wheelies when i get it ( some day now ).

i thank all of you for your input. maybe that winch is holding me back now.

Hey choop
I am running no shims in my 02
Belt squeals abit @ idle in gear...but I can live with that
Belt will last a very long time in that condition

after I installed the winch on my p700, it was MUCH harder to get the front wheels up. Even after several small mods like k&n filter, snorkel, clutch springs, exhaust, it still wasn't snapping up like I was used to. After I installed the holeshot module, it made the most difference. From a dead stop you can't keep the front end down if you mash the throttle, but it still isn't easy to get up at speed. I enjoy being able to lift the front end over trail obstacles, I've even considered removing the winch. The winch just comes in so darn handy.
